I wasn't entirely satisfied with this response as it made no mention of the role of the Pauli exclusion principle in providing the neutron degeneracy pressure in the supernova mechanism.
I quizzed GPT-4o about it.

View attachment 353566
ChatGPT did a better job the first time. That was until you tried to convince it neutron degeneracy pressure was important and it fell for it. Even in cold neutron stars degeneracy pressure isn't dominant. In baby proto-neutron stars inside supernovae, it is even less so. Collapse is halted because of the repulsive core of the nucleon-nucleon interaction that makes further compression difficult. The only real error the first ChatGPT output made was to call a neutron star "incompressible".

This furthers my impression that AI tools like ChatGPT can be treated like authorities, but they are certainly "persuadable".

The mistake made by ChatGPT in point (3) of post #34, it referred to a core rebound without describing the mechanism of the rebound.
The core rebound due to neutron degeneracy pressure lasts for around 20 ms during which time frame shocks waves are produced and magnified by colliding infalling matter with the rebounding core.

The nuclear force is strongly attractive in the range 0.8 -2.5 fm, below 0.7 fm it becomes strongly repulsive due to the Pauli exclusion principle and is found in neutron scattering experiments which supports the theory of the core rebounding during the supernova process.
